Lily: What’s wrong, Judy
Judy: Well, my parents aren’t happy with my grades.
Lily: Really Weren’t they pretty good this term
Judy: Yeah, but my parents have very high standards. They often
compare me with my cousin, Kate. She gets better grades,
plays the piano well, often wins awards ...
Lily: I’m sorry to hear that. But look on the bright side. I’m sure your parents
just want you to do well, although they may not show it.
be happy/pleased/satisfied with 对.....满意
compare... with... 把.....和.....作比较
look on the bright side 从好的方面想; 抱乐观态度
What’s wrong 怎么了 /出什么事了
相当于“What’s up/the matter/the trouble ”
be sure+(that)从句 确信……
Judy: I know my parents love me, but sometimes I think they love Kate more.
Lily: Why don’t you talk to them Until you talk to them, they might not
know how you feel.
Judy: I’m afraid I’ll cry if we talk.
Lily: How about writing them a letter so that you can get your message
across clearly
Judy: Oh, that’s a good idea.
Lily: Writing things down can also make you feel better.
Judy: Thanks! Just talking to you makes me feel better already!
How/What about... ……怎么样?
后接名词、代词或动词-ing形式。
write sb. a letter 给某人写信
so that 为了;以便
get across 解释清楚; 传达
动名词短语作主语,谓语动词用第三人称单数形式。
Why don’t you do sth. 为什么不做某事呢?用于向对方提出建议或征求对方的意见,相当于“Why not do sth.?”。
